选择应用镜像(如WordPress镜像)还是自选系统镜像(如纯净CentOS/Ubuntu),取决于你的技术能力、项目需求、安全要求、可维护性及长期规划。以下是关键维度的对比分析,帮你做出理性决策:
✅ 推荐场景与建议:
| 维度 | 应用镜像(如WordPress一键镜像) | 自选基础系统镜像(如Ubuntu 22.04) |
|---|---|---|
| 适合人群 | 初学者、快速建站、临时测试、非技术运营人员 | 开发者、运维人员、有定制/扩展需求者、中大型项目 |
| 部署速度 | ⚡ 极快(5分钟内可访问网站) | ⏳ 较慢(需手动安装LAMP/LEMP、配置Nginx/Apache、PHP、MySQL、WP等) |
| 预装内容 | 已集成WordPress + Web服务器 + 数据库 + PHP + 基础安全配置(如防火墙规则) | 纯净系统,无任何应用,完全自主控制 |
| 安全性 | ❗风险较高: • 镜像可能含过期组件或默认弱口令(如 admin/admin)• 预装插件/主题可能带漏洞 • 更新滞后(厂商未及时同步WP官方补丁) |
✅ 更高可控性: • 可严格遵循最小安装原则 • 自主选择可信源(如官方APT仓库)、启用自动安全更新 • 可配置Fail2ban、WAF、权限隔离等深度防护 |
| 可维护性 & 扩展性 | ⚠️ 有限: • 升级路径不透明(升级镜像可能覆盖配置) • 难以集成CI/CD、缓存(Redis/Varnish)、对象存储、多站点等高级架构 |
✅ 强大灵活: • 支持任意架构演进(Docker化、负载均衡、微服务化) • 易于编写Ansible/Terraform脚本实现IaC(基础设施即代码) • 日志、监控、备份策略可精细化定制 |
| 合规与审计 | ❌ 难以满足等保2.0、GDPR等要求(缺乏完整软件清单、配置基线不可控) | ✅ 可全程留痕、生成符合规范的加固报告(如CIS Benchmark) |
🔍 真实案例参考:
- ✅ 选应用镜像:个人博客、企业官网MVP验证、活动专题页(生命周期<3个月)
- ✅ 选基础镜像:电商网站(需支付对接/会员体系)、SaaS后台、需接入内部LDAP/OAuth、计划后续迁移到K8s集群
💡 折中优化方案(强烈推荐):
👉 使用「云厂商提供的「安全加固版」基础镜像」+「自动化部署脚本」
例如:
- 阿里云「Ubuntu 22.04 安全增强版」 +
wp-cli+ Ansible一键部署脚本 - 腾讯云「CentOS Stream 9 最小化镜像」 + Docker Compose 部署 WordPress(含Nginx+PHP-FPM+MariaDB+Redis缓存)
→ 兼顾安全性、可控性、效率,且便于版本回滚和团队协作。
⚠️ 重要提醒:
- 无论哪种方式,必须立即修改默认密码(数据库root、WordPress管理员、SSH密钥);
- 生产环境禁用WordPress后台文件编辑功能(
define('DISALLOW_FILE_EDIT', true);); - 启用定期自动备份(数据库+文件)并异地存储;
- 建议搭配Web应用防火墙(WAF) 和 CDN(隐藏源站IP) 提升防护。
✅ 结论:
除非你是纯新手且仅需临时演示,否则强烈建议选择基础系统镜像 + 自动化部署方案。
它看似前期投入稍多,但换来的是长期稳定性、安全性、可维护性与技术成长空间——这正是云服务器价值的核心所在。
需要的话,我可以为你提供:
- 一份精简可靠的 Ubuntu + Docker + WordPress 生产级部署脚本
- 或 CIS标准加固的 CentOS 9 手动配置清单
欢迎随时提出 👍
CLOUD云枢